Output 3cd4593d6f180886b7de8afbc31f6c8109a5ec454bbce95c53eb9c0d16d2bdee:1

value
10904014
script pubkey
OP_0 OP_PUSHBYTES_20 682c8f6fa81daaefe0ccabcd08878eff742923f5
address
bc1qdqkg7magrk4wlcxv40xs3puwla6zjgl4np0j2k
transaction
3cd4593d6f180886b7de8afbc31f6c8109a5ec454bbce95c53eb9c0d16d2bdee
spent
true